Overview
QPM5811EVB01 from Qorvo is an evaluation board designed to accelerate development and characterization of the QPM5811 GaAs MMIC T/R module - a 8.5–10.5 GHz front-end module integrating T/R switch, LNA (26 dB gain, 2.0 dB NF), and PA (27.5 dBm pulsed output, 45% PAE). It supports X-band phased array radar prototyping with RF interfaces optimized for Southwest Microwave 2.92 mm end-launch connectors.
For engineers reviewing the QPM5811EVB01 datasheet, pinout, applications, or equivalent options, this board enables rapid validation of RF performance, bias sequencing, thermal behavior, and switching timing of the QPM5811 under real-world pulsed and CW conditions across −40°C to +85°C.
Technical Context
The QPM5811EVB01 implements a fully populated, impedance-matched microstrip layout using Rogers RO4003C (εr = 3.35) substrate with 0.008″ thickness and 0.5 oz copper layers. It provides direct access to all QPM5811 control pins (VG_PA, TXSW, RXSW, VREF, VSS), DC supplies (VD_PA, VD_LNA), and RF ports (TXIN/RXOUT, TXOUT/RXIN) via SMA-compatible 2.92 mm end-launch connectors (J1, J2).
Bias-up/down sequencing is implemented per Qorvo's documented procedure: VG_PA must be set before drain supplies; TXSW/RXSW transitions require Mode 3 (both OFF) as interim state for ≥5 ns; and gate current limits are enforced at ≤10 mA. The board includes decoupling networks (1000 pF, 10 µF) and 10 Ω series resistors on control lines to suppress ringing.
Key Specifications
| Parameter | Value and Actual Design Meaning |
|---|---|
| Base Module | QPM5811 GaAs MMIC T/R module (8.5–10.5 GHz, 27.5 dBm pulsed, 2.0 dB NF) |
| Substrate | Rogers RO4003C, εr = 3.35, 0.008″ thick - ensures stable phase response and low dispersion in X-band |
| RF Connectors | Southwest Microwave 1092-01A-5, 2.92 mm end-launch - supports full 8.5–10.5 GHz bandwidth with <−10 dB return loss |
| DC Decoupling | 1000 pF (0402/0603), 10 µF (1206) X7R/X5R ceramics - suppresses supply noise up to 1 GHz |
| Control Line Termination | 10 Ω series resistors (R2, R5, R1) - dampens reflections and prevents overshoot on 3.3 V logic-controlled TXSW/RXSW/VG_PA lines |
| ESD Protection | MSL Level 3 per J-STD-020; HBM 1A, CDM C3 - requires handling per ESD-sensitive protocols |

FAQ
What is the primary function of the QPM5811EVB01?
The QPM5811EVB01 is an evaluation board purpose-built to characterize and validate the QPM5811 GaAs MMIC T/R module. It provides calibrated RF paths, controlled bias sequencing, and accessible test points for measuring receive noise figure, transmit power, switching time, harmonic suppression, and thermal performance across the full 8.5–10.5 GHz band under pulsed and CW conditions.
Does the QPM5811EVB01 support both pulsed and continuous-wave operation of the QPM5811?
Yes, the QPM5811EVB01 supports both operational modes. Its PCB layout, decoupling network, and connector interface are validated for pulsed RF testing (100 µs pulse width, 10% duty cycle) and CW measurements. The board accommodates external pulse generators and RF signal analyzers, and its thermal design sustains QPM5811 channel temperatures up to 119.7°C during worst-case pulsed operation.
Which RF connectors are used on the QPM5811EVB01, and why were they selected?
The QPM5811EVB01 uses Southwest Microwave 1092-01A-5 2.92 mm end-launch connectors (J1 and J2). These connectors were selected for their broadband performance (DC to 40 GHz), low insertion loss (<0.15 dB at 10 GHz), and precise launch geometry onto the RO4003C microstrip - ensuring minimal discontinuity and verified <−10 dB return loss across the QPM5811's 8.5–10.5 GHz operating band.
How does the QPM5811EVB01 implement bias sequencing for the QPM5811?
The QPM5811EVB01 follows Qorvo's documented bias-up/bias-down sequence: VG_PA is set first (to −3.3 V or −0.7 V), then VD_PA and VD_LNA are applied; TXSW/RXSW transitions require Mode 3 (both OFF) for ≥5 ns between states. The board includes 10 Ω series resistors on control lines and dedicated test points for monitoring VG_PA, VD_PA, and VD_LNA to ensure compliance with absolute maximum ratings and optimal quiescent current stability.
Is thermal management addressed on the QPM5811EVB01, and how does it relate to QPM5811 specifications?
Yes - the QPM5811EVB01 PCB layout allocates thermal relief pads and ground plane area beneath the QPM5811's 6 × 6 mm QFN package to enhance heat dissipation. This supports the QPM5811's specified thermal resistance (θJC = 33.0 °C/W under pulsed worst-case conditions) and enables sustained operation at baseplate temperatures up to +85°C while maintaining channel temperature below 119.7°C, as verified in Qorvo's thermal characterization data.
